Christian Magic
What is magic?
To understand Christian magic we must first define magic; what it is and what it can do, this post will go over the basic definition of magic and how it relates to Christianity.
Christians: In order to practice magic you must understand it first.
Magic has not always had the definition we have of it now, some see the word magic and think of malefic curses and spells, satanic rituals and blood sacrifices, but magic actually describes a very broad concept that isn't strictly defined as negative.
While the origin of the word is still contested, Magic stems from the associations "to be able" "to interact with" "to posses" in terms of knowledge and practice of spirituality, faith, worship and all other supernatural qualities.
So the word magic, describes a general concept of dealings with the supernatural, the superhuman, the mysterious, all things naturally attributed to the mystical nature and interactions with God.
So When did magic begin taking on negative connotations?
as language and Christianity developed, so did the cultures and agendas of the places it was developed in. Slowly, because of political and prejudiced reasons, the word magic which dealt with general supernatural energies began to become related with concepts of con artists, charlatans and other dangerous practices.
As christianity strayed from it's original path, the word magic was slowly separated from the inherently mystical energies and supernatural nature of God and Christian worship, turning it into dealings with demons and Satan exclusively. As christianity became an organized religion, the definitions of it's words came under the control of the powers of this world-Satan, and as men "defined" Christianity, it cannibalized itself and it's understanding of God, spirituality and enlightenmet.
Because Satan wanted control and to strip spiritual power away from the church, organized Christianity began wrongfully categorizing any and all forms of spirituality that the leaders didn't want others practicing, as something separate from God therefore making it something against God and calling it "Witchcraft" which is meant to describe only harmful magical practices. It was during these times that Satan injected confusion into the church and took many spiritual power and knowledge away from us and labeled it demonic to keep us afraid and ignorant. Once you realize this you begin to take your power back.
So what would define Christian Magic?
Since magic is a general term to describe the existence of supernatural energies we can interact with and use, Christian magic is defined as magic use under the instruction and will of God with an understanding of the world from a Christian point of view and practice.
Magic and God was never separate. forms of worship we would see as magical and witchcraft nowadays was common practice in early Christian groups, it was when power hungry men saw the power in Christianity they can use for themselves, that they began distorting language to confuse and erase God's character and turn it into something they could control and harm others with.

Imbolc verses for Christian Witches
Song of Solomon(Songs) 2:11-12
For behold, the winter is past; the rain is over and gone. The flowers appear on the earth, the time of singing has come, and the voice of the turtledove is heard in our land.
Ecclesiastes 3:1-8
For everything there is a season, and a time for every matter under heaven: a time to be born, and a time to die; a time to plant, and a time to pluck up what is planted; a time to kill, and a time to heal; a time to break down, and a time to build up; a time to weep, and a time to laugh; a time to mourn, and a time to dance; a time to cast away stones, and a time to gather stones together; a time to embrace, and a time to refrain from embracing; a time to seek, and a time to lose; a time to keep, and a time to cast away; a time to tear, and a time to sew; a time to keep silence, and a time to speak; a time to love, and a time to hate; a time for war, and a time for peace.
Isaiah 61:11
For as the earth brings forth its sprouts, and as a garden causes what is sown in it to sprout up, so the Lord God will cause righteousness and praise to sprout up before all the nations.
Genesis 1:14
And God said, “Let there be lights in the expanse of the heavens to separate the day from the night. And let them be for signs and for seasons, and for days and years,
As the seasons change, remember that our God is unchanging.
Hebrews 13:8
Jesus Christ is the same yesterday and today and forever.
These are just a few, but hopefully they’ll get you started on your Imbolc ceremony (if you do one)
